Transaction fd824ce66df9e312e7b4814acf1c633ba8e65338ce5ff0e45ea7991bd3f5d094
2 Input
2 Outputs
- fd824ce66df9e312e7b4814acf1c633ba8e65338ce5ff0e45ea7991bd3f5d094:0
- fd824ce66df9e312e7b4814acf1c633ba8e65338ce5ff0e45ea7991bd3f5d094:1
value 501797612
address 17vSJtgofL4pY4SZDxjGuJBuwXSerTSYdM
value 1011742
address 1HhLYrMzSkbmfS3WiuwErnU1P8su162Kcp